High pressure system pressure reduction. |
WARNING The injection system is in a high pressure system (max. approx. 120 bar) and a low pressure system (approx. 6 bar). |
The fuel pressure in the high-pressure section must be reduced to a residual pressure of 6 bar prior to opening the high-pressure system. The procedure to do so is described below. |
|
WARNING The fuel piping is exposed to fuel pressure. Wear safety goggles and appropriate clothing to avoid injury and contact with skin. Before opening the high-pressure system, place a cloth around the connection. |
|
–
| Place a clean cloth around the line connection, and open it carefully to eliminate the residual pressure of approx. 6 bar. Any spilt fuel must be cleaned up. |
–
| Once the work has been completed, consult the fault memory and erase all faults in memory due to disconnecting the connector. |
